Big3 League Is Investigating Allen Iverson's No-Show
Photo: Streeter Lecka/ [object Object] The Big3 league said it is investigating Allen Iverson’s absence after the Hall of Famer failed to show up for a game in Dallas on Sunday.
Never known for reliably showing up on time—or even showing up at all—Iverson, far and away the biggest star of the whole thing, skipping the Dallas game is undoubtedly a blow for the fledgling league.
Listed as a player and a coach for the team 3s Company, Iverson has mostly stayed on the sideline since the league launched in June. Each week, the league’s eight teams travel to a different city around the country. The week before Dallas, Iverson was with his team in Chicago, where he was photographed gambling at a casino, per TMZ.
